Top pitching prospect Gavin Stone was impressive, striking out eight in his three innings in relief.

The Dodgers were held to three hits in a 6-3 loss to the Oakland A’s Sunday afternoon at Camelback Ranch.: Right-hander Dustin May went a ragged four innings. He gave up a two-run home run to Shea Langerliers in the first inning then loaded the bases in the second inning with a single and two walks after there were two outs.

He struck out Ryan Noda to end that inning and retired seven of the final eight batters he faced, throwing 72 pitches over his four innings. … Jimmy Nelson started the fifth inning. He threw 14 pitches. Only one was a strike . He walked three batters, hit another and threw a wild pitch that scored a run. Over his past two outings, Nelson has walked seven of the nine batters he has faced and hit another. … Top pitching prospect Gavin Stone struck out eight in three scoreless innings.
